1 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Tom Pearson November 15, 2006
2 Alberta Petrochemical Industry - History Proposed in 1974 by Premier Peter Lougheed in response to demand for Alberta oil by Ontario petrochemical industry didn t want to ship petrochemical jobs to Sarnia Alberta had been investigating ethane based petrochemical manufacturing technology The Lougheed government felt that Alberta should have its own petrochemical industry to diversify the economy Pg. 2
3 Alberta Petrochemical Industry - History Initial Corporate Involvement Dow Chemical Canada Alberta Gas Trunk Line Alberta Gas Ethylene Dome Petroleum Construction Period: Startup of New Facilities: September 1979 Pg. 3
4 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Alberta Gas Trunk Line (AGTL) Alberta Natural Gas extraction/straddle plant in Cochrane Empress extraction/straddle plant Alberta Ethane Gathering System (AEGS) supplied ethane from Cochrane and Empress to AGE E- E 1 ethylene plant in Joffre Pg. 4
5 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Alberta Gas Ethylene (AGE) - Joffre Alberta Gas Ethylene established by Alberta government and eventually became part of NOVA E-1 1 Ethylene Plant (Ethane Cracker) Ethylene Pipeline to Dow Fort Saskatchewan Diamond Shamrock Alberta Gas (now Oxyvinyls) ) PVC - Scotford Pg. 5
6 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Ethane Feedstock Regulations Alberta Petrochemical Industry had First Call on all ethane feedstock Supply and Price of Ethane feedstock guaranteed by Alberta government Exports of ethane limited to amounts not required by Alberta Petrochemical Industry Pg. 6
7 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Dow Chemical Canada Fort Saskatchewan Ethylene Dichloride/Vinyl Chloride Monomer Chlor-Alkali (Chlorine and Caustic) Ethylene Oxide/Ethylene Glycol Ethylene Storage Wells Power and Utilities Two Cogen Power Units Pg. 7
8 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Dome Petroleum 1800 mile Cochin Pipeline from Fort Saskatchewan to Sarnia, Ontario Products shipped: Ethylene to Dow Chemical Canada, Sarnia,, Ontario facilities Pg. 8
9 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Original Facilities Dome Petroleum Products shipped: Ethane (amounts not required by Alberta petrochemical industry) Propane Pg. 9
10 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Alberta Gas Ethylene E-2 E 2 Ethane Cracker Joffre Alberta Gas Ethylene Polyethylene Joffre (Unipol process licensed from Union Carbide) Dow Chemical Train 1 Polyethylene Fort Saskatchewan Pg. 10
11 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Union Carbide (now Dow Chemical) P1 Glycol - Prentiss Shell Chemical Styrene - Scotford ICI (now AT Plastics) Polyethylene - Edmonton Celanese Vinyl Acetate and Methanol - Edmonton Pg. 11
12 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Dow Chemical LHC-1 1 Ethane Cracker Fort Saskatchewan Dow Chemical Natural Gas Liquids Fractionator Fort Saskatchewan (JV with Shell Canada) Dow Chemical Train 2 Polyethylene Fort Saskatchewan Pg. 12
13 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Union Carbide (now Dow Chemical) P2 Ethylene Glycol Prentiss All existing Dow Ethylene derivative plants expanded (Chlor ( Chlor- alkali, VCM/EDC, EO/EG, Polyethylene) Celanese expanded extruded Cellulose Acetate Pg. 13
14 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Dow Chemical LHC-1 1 Ethane Cracker 100% Expansion Fort Saskatchewan Dow Chemical Train 3 Polyethylene Fort Saskatchewan Pg. 14
15 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ions NOVA E-3 E 3 Ethane Cracker Joffre (50% JV with Union Carbide now Dow Chemical) NOVA Sclairtech Polyethylene Joffre NOVA Cogen Power Units (4) - Joffre Amoco Linear Alpha Olefins (LAO) Plant - Joffre Pg. 15
16 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Union Carbide (now Dow Chemical) LP7 Polyethylene - Prentiss Dow Chemical Third Cogen Power Unit Fort Saskatchewan Shell Canada Ethylene Glycol Scotford NOVA Joffre Ethane Extraction Pg. 16
17 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Shell Chemical Cogen Power Unit - Scotford Shell Canada Cogen Power Unit Scotford Pg. 17
18 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Alberta Petrochemical Industry annual revenue now approaching $9 Billion per year Second largest industry in Alberta Pg. 18
19 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Expansions Total Alberta Petrochemical Industry 7000 direct jobs & 14,000 indirect jobs Total Salary $1.7 Billion per year Alberta income tax paid: $168 million per year Alberta property tax paid: $92 million per year Pg. 19
20 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E 2001 Celanese Vinyl Acetate, Acetic Acid, Formaldehyde & Penta Erythrol plants shutdown Loss of 310 direct jobs & 620 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$75 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$10 million per year Pg. 20
21 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E 2002 Dow Chemical 1968 Chlor-alkali plant shutdown Loss of 35 direct jobs & 70 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$8.4 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$1.6 million per year Pg. 21
22 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E 2003 Dow Chemical Fort Saskatchewan $75 million Ethane Cracker expansion delayed indefinitely Pg. 22
23 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E 2005 Celanese Cellulose Acetate I (cigarette tow) plant shutdown Loss of 200 direct jobs & 400 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$48 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$7 million per year Pg. 23
24 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E January 2006 Oxyvinyls PolyVinyl Chloride resin plant shutdown Loss of 55 direct jobs &110 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$13 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$2.6 million per year Pg. 24
25 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E March 2006 Dow Chemical Vinyl Chloride Monomer plant shutdown Loss of 40 direct jobs & 80 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$10 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$1.7 million per year Pg. 25
26 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E October 2006 Dow Chemical Ethylene Dichloride and Chlor-alkali plants shutdown Loss of 220 direct jobs & 440 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$53 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$7.6 million per year Pg. 26
27 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E April 2007 Celanese Cellulose Acetate II and Methanol plants shutdown Loss of 240 direct jobs & 480 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$58 million per year Alberta income and property tax reduction of $8 million per year Pg. 27
28 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E Total Cost of Celanese Site Shutdown Loss of 750 direct jobs & 1500 indirect jobs Alberta salary reduction of $180 million per year Alberta income tax reduction of $18 million per year Alberta property tax reduction of $7.5 million per year Pg. 28
29 Alberta Petrochemical Industry DECLINE What Happened?? Pg. 29
30 Alberta Petrochemical Industry ISSUES High cost natural gas in North America Alliance Pipeline and other ethane supply constraints Lack of petrochemical industry investment incentives in Alberta Pg. 30
31 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Natural Gas High cost natural gas has made North American industry uncompetitive North American natural gas production forecast to be flat at best Increased North American natural gas demand due to population growth, new gas fired power plants, and oil sands development Pg. 31
32 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Natural Gas Historic US$1.00/MMBtu gas price differential compared to U.S. Gulf is now reduced MacKenzie Delta gas may help by pushing wetter gas currently burned for fuel in Fort McMurray south into central Alberta as long as new oil sands development doesn t use it all!! (alternative upgraders can gasify petroleum coke byproduct to produce fuel gas) Pg. 32
33 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Alberta petrochemical industry is currently short 30,000 40,000 BPD of ethane Alberta ethane royalty is the same as that for natural gas but is less than royalties for propane and butane Pg. 33
34 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Ethane is more valuable as a feedstock than as a fuel, i.e. Albertans are not receiving full resource value for ethane New ethane extraction capacity expensive relative to existing at Empress and Cochrane applies to both deep cut and field extraction Petrochemicals from oil sands off- gases and byproducts even more expensive Pg. 34
35 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Additional extraction possible if Alberta is considered more competitive than U.S. Gulf in a North American context No economic incentives exist to encourage extraction of more ethane in Alberta, either via deeper cuts at Empress and Cochrane or via new field extraction plants that have access to existing collection pipelines Pg. 35
36 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Alliance Pipeline 2001: $5 Billion 3000 km natural gas and liquids pipeline from NW Alberta to Chicago (Alberta gov t.. removed original ethane export restrictions) Aux Sable Fractionator located 75 km SW of Chicago to extract liquids Ships BCF/day natural gas plus up to 80,000 BBL/day natural gas liquids consisting of ethane, propane, and butane (30,000 40,000 BBL/day ethane ½ from NE B.C.) Pg. 36
37 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Alliance Pipeline Ethane extracted at Aux Sable fractionator is sold to Equistar which produces ethylene and ethylene derivatives (export of manufacturing jobs to U.S.) Ethane formerly supplied to Equistar from U. S. Gulf is now available to ethylene producers in Texas and Louisiana (Dow Chemical has six ethane crackers in the U. S. Gulf) Thanks, Alberta!! Pg. 37
38 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Alliance Pipeline Shipping tariffs are based on volume so pipeline economics are optimized by maximizing higher BTU liquids in the gas stream (NGL s ( are the basis of the pipeline economics) Export of NGL s is subsidized by natural gas Pg. 38
39 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Alliance Pipeline Alberta is no longer on the petrochemical industry expansion radar screen Why? Availability of economic ethane feedstock is very uncertain A significant piece of the Alberta Advantage is now viewed as exported to the U.S. Gulf as well as Alberta jobs Pg. 39
40 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Alliance Pipeline Alliance Pipeline was a watershed event, a paradigm shift for the Alberta Petrochemical Industry equivalent to moving all Canadian auto manufacturing to Detroit or Canadian aircraft manufacturing to Boeing in Seattle Pg. 40
41 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Dow Strategy Future expansions of Alberta ethylene and ethylene derivative plants are no longer considered due to ethane supply concerns Alliance Pipeline exacerbated an already tight Alberta ethane supply situation Investment in the Alberta Petrochemical Industry ceased with startup of the Alliance Pipeline Pg. 41
42 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Dow Strategy Ethane formerly supplied to Equistar now available to Dow plants in U.S. Gulf (Thanks, Alberta!!) New Dow petrochemical investment now in Kuwait, Oman, Saudi Arabia, Malaysia and eventually China Pg. 42
43 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Investment Incentives Increase provincial royalties on extracted ethane intended for export (possible NAFTA issue but not necessarily) Ten year property tax exemption on new manufacturing facilities - are routinely available in Texas and Louisiana Restore Manufacturing and Processing Tax Credits Pg. 43
44 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Investment Incentives Restore 3-year 3 writeoffs for new manufacturing facilities. 25%-50% 50%- 25% CCA rates were in place until late 1980 s Restore Investment Tax Credits. ITC was 7% in 1984, phased out by 1988 Energy and Water Conservation Tax Credits Zero or low interest rate loans Pg. 44
45 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Investment Incentives Government guaranteed loans R&D investment incentives Flow-through tax treatment for new manufacturing investments Government infrastructure investment Promote upgrading of tar sands by- products and off-gases instead of burning them for fuel Pg. 45
46 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Investment Incentives Venture capital incentives Industry/government partnerships (example: SGF/Petromont in Quebec) Reduce provincial royalties on ethane at wellhead and upgraders to encourage local extraction (has been recently announced but only on incremental ethane) Pg. 46
47 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Policy Develop a long term ethane feedstock policy for the province incorporating both legislative and financial instruments to promote upgrading of Alberta s resources instead of exporting them at the first exportable level!! This also applies to bitumen and bitumen by-products!! Pg. 47
48 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Policy Support an economically viable ethane extraction system to gather Alberta ethane Keep sufficient quantities of Alberta ethane in the province required by the petrochemical industry for capacity operation (similar to Alberta government policy in the 1970s) Pg. 48
49 Alberta Petrochemical Industry Ethane Policy The Premier of Alberta likes to state that the Alberta government is not in the business of being in business. However, the Alberta government made the business decision to allow the export of Alberta ethane via the Alliance pipeline and as such is obligated to rectify the hugely negative effects of that decision. Pg. 49
50 Alberta Petrochemical Industry FUTURE RISK Direct shipment via pipelines of Alberta oil sands bitumen to U.S. refineries or to Kitimat/Prince Rupert for upgrading in the Far East will limit future oil sands upgrading in Alberta and represents a huge export of Alberta jobs to the U.S. and the Far East Pg. 50
51 Alberta Petrochemical Industry FUTURE RISK Export of Alberta oil sands bitumen to U.S. refineries or to the Far East for upgrading also guarantees the upgrader by- products, including ethane, propane and butane, will not be available for the Alberta petrochemical industry Pg. 51
